New EU4Digital Academy offers Eastern Partnership citizens and enterprises training
EU4Digital has launched EU4Digital Academy, a digital learning programme bringing free and accessible digital skills training to the Eastern partner countries. EU4Digital Academy provides user-friendly, web-based courses tailored to the needs of small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and citizens of countries in the Eastern Partnership region – Armenia, Azerbaijan, Georgia, Moldova and Ukraine.

Ukraine approves resolution for launch of ‘Mriya’ educational app
Ukrainian government ministers supported a resolution that allows the launch of the educational mobile application ‘Mriya’. The app aims to provide all citizens with equal access to knowledge and will allow children, parents and teachers to navigate a modernised and more effective process for education.

Device Coalition donates 3,600 laptops for Ukrainian schoolchildren
Schoolchildren in the Kharkiv region of Ukraine received laptops to support their online learning. The Device Coalition, with financial support from the European Union, gave 3,600 laptops for students who are forced to study remotely due to the ongoing war in the region. This will help children to continue to access high-quality education.

Moldova to join €7.5 billion Digital Europe Programme
Moldova's accession agreement to the Digital Europe Programme permits businesses and authorities to access EU funding for digitalisation projects with a budget of €7.5 billion for 2021-2027.

Moldovan teachers strengthen innovative learning skills with EU support
Teachers in the Republic of Moldova took part in training to strengthen innovative student-centred teaching and learning practices, in the first days of 2024. Ninety teachers from the cities of Cahul and Ungheni joined the programme, which is part of the ‘EU4Moldova: Focal Regions’ project.

EBRD and IFC invest in Ukrainian-founded edtech leader Preply
The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D) and the International Finance Corporation (IFC) have jointly invested $10 million in Preply, a prominent online language learning platform originating in Ukraine. This collaboration, in partnership with growth equity fund manager Horizon Capital, aims to fortify Ukraine's technology sector and foster innovative solutions for economic recovery.
